Using one linked dataflow source to filter another linked dataflow source produces buggy operation.

Hi there,

 

I am using two dataflow data sources (A1&A2) in a second dataflow (B), where using A1 to filter A2 as part of transformation , it produced prelonged and buggy result in terms of saving the second dataflow and refreshing turnover.  However if I change A1 to the original direct datasource (which is sharepoint Online) , it produces much faster and stabler result. Does anyone know if it's an exisiting issue with how dataflow engine works or is there any remedical approach i can adopt? 

 

I prefer using one orignal data source in one dataflow, and using dataflow as the data sources in the following dataflow, which is easier to control source data.
